Years 1-5: Building the Foundation

The first five years of marriage focus on traditional anniversary gifts made from delicate yet meaningful materials that represent growth and adaptation. These early years establish patterns of gift-giving and celebration that many couples maintain throughout their marriage.

First Year – Paper Anniversary Gift Ideas

The paper anniversary gift for year one symbolizes the blank page of your new marriage and the fragility of early love. Popular 2026 paper gift trends include custom wedding vow art prints, personalized stationery sets, concert tickets, or handwritten love letters bound in beautiful paper. Many couples create photo books documenting their first year together, making this traditional gift deeply personal and meaningful.

Second Year – Cotton Anniversary Celebrations

Cotton anniversary gifts represent the interwoven nature of your lives becoming more comfortable and interconnected. Luxury cotton bedding, matching cotton robes, or custom cotton canvas prints make excellent choices. In 2026, eco-conscious couples often choose organic cotton products or support fair-trade cotton artisans, adding social responsibility to their traditional gift exchange.

Third Year – Leather Anniversary Options

Leather anniversary gifts symbolize durability and protection as your relationship becomes more resilient. Quality leather goods like handcrafted wallets, personalized leather journals, or matching leather accessories remain timeless choices. Modern couples in 2026 often select vegan leather alternatives or vintage leather pieces to align with contemporary values while honoring tradition.

Fourth and Fifth Year Milestone Gifts

Year four brings fruit or flowers anniversary gifts representing natural growth and beauty, while year five celebrates with wood symbolizing strong roots. Fresh fruit subscriptions, flowering plants, or custom wooden furniture pieces make memorable choices. Many couples plant trees together for their fifth anniversary, creating a living symbol of their growing love that will flourish for decades.

Years 6-10: Strengthening the Bond

The second half of the first decade introduces stronger materials that reflect the increasing stability and sweetness found in established marriages. These traditional anniversary gifts by year mark important transitions as couples settle into deeper patterns of love and commitment.

Sixth and Seventh Year Traditional Gifts

Year six offers choices between candy or iron anniversary gifts, representing both sweetness and strength. Gourmet chocolate collections or wrought iron home décor pieces both honor tradition beautifully. The seventh year brings copper anniversary gifts or wool, with copper jewelry, cookware, or cozy wool blankets providing warmth and conducting positive energy between partners.

Eighth Through Tenth Year Celebrations

Bronze anniversary gifts for year eight symbolize the beautiful patina that develops over time, just like marriages. Bronze sculptures, cookware, or jewelry pieces make stunning choices. Years nine and ten feature pottery and tin or aluminum respectively, with handmade pottery classes or lightweight aluminum camping gear reflecting both tradition and modern lifestyles that active couples embrace in 2026.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the traditional anniversary gifts for the first 10 years?

The traditional anniversary gifts for years 1-10 are: paper (1st), cotton (2nd), leather (3rd), fruit/flowers (4th), wood (5th), candy/iron (6th), wool/copper (7th), bronze/pottery (8th), pottery/willow (9th), and tin/aluminum (10th). Each material symbolizes the growing strength and beauty of your relationship.

Why do traditional anniversary gifts by year follow this specific pattern?

Traditional anniversary gifts progress from fragile materials like paper to precious metals like gold and platinum, symbolizing how marriages strengthen over time. This pattern originated in medieval Europe and reflects the belief that relationships begin delicate but develop increasing value, durability, and beauty with each passing year.
